How Material Quality and Design Impact the Popularity of Metal Room Dividers?

Material quality is a significant factor in the appeal of decorative metal room dividers. High-quality metals such as stainless steel, aluminum, or brass ensure durability, resistance to wear, and long-lasting beauty. Premium finishes, including powder coating, anodizing, or custom paints, further enhance aesthetic appeal while protecting surfaces from damage.

Design intricacy also matters. Dividers with unique patterns, laser-cut motifs, or three-dimensional textures attract attention and create focal points in hotel interiors. The combination of material quality and innovative design ensures that decorative metal dividers remain a preferred choice among hotel designers seeking long-lasting and visually striking solutions.

Why Hotel Designers Prefer Decorative Metal Room Dividers Over Traditional Partitions?

Compared to traditional partitions or walls, decorative metal room dividers offer several advantages. They are lightweight, easy to install, and provide flexibility in layout changes. Unlike permanent walls, metal dividers do not require construction work, reducing installation time and costs.

Additionally, metal dividers can serve dual purposes. Beyond separating spaces, they act as decorative elements that enhance branding and style. Hotels can use dividers to create visually cohesive environments that align with interior design themes. This multifunctionality makes decorative metal room dividers a practical and stylish alternative to conventional partitions.
